Output 76db903a411f6142a117fb1e508211be252d5a24cc774f71e775e93b562e3b51:4

value
655618237
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9f2b9e119ffe3beb3283aff8d7030cd7cc50268 OP_EQUALVERIFY OP_CHECKSIG
address
1LsQQXqXfXTtqkrfE7W66uAPFLvS1iqbUg
transaction
76db903a411f6142a117fb1e508211be252d5a24cc774f71e775e93b562e3b51
spent
true